One of the things I'm really impressed by (and which that photo reveals) is all the subtle shading in the skin tone. I had to take a picture that basically eliminated all the texture detail in the hood to show that aspect off, but I think it does come out. There's an almost reddish "blush" there that adds immensely to the realism of the piece, but is so subtle that you can completely wash it out trying to capture details in the cloak or clasp.
 
The overall design and flesh colors really show this is a hybrid of ROTS and Jedi. The shape of McDiarmid's face is defnitely more slim as it was in Jedi, but the more normal flesh coloration and all the small detailing of the deformation come from ROTS.

Agreed. I do find that if you light it like he was lit in ROTJ with tight spotlight just on the face, it looks *very* Jedi. If you go for a more even lighting, it looks very ROTS. So it's neat that you can get both looks so easily.
 
Well, even under similar lighting to Jedi, he never totally looked like it in ROTS because of his jawline and neck acutally aging and becoming fuller, he almost looked bloated at times. Jedi's a skinny young man turned old.
